SAR and County Discuss Hirst Decision

  
 
 
 
Members of the SAR Governmental Affairs committee  met with Spokane County water resources officials, this week, to offer REALTOR ® input on a "Hirst Fix."

The mutual goal is to create a durable solution under current law to work around the Hirst Decision - last year's ruling by the Washington State Supreme Court that effectively shuts down all rural development across Washington state.

Members offered County planners real information from the field as they work to create a water bank for property owners in the Little Spokane River water shed - one of several areas impacted by Hirst in Spokane County.


SAR photo

The meeting (pictured above) was part of an ongoing dialogue between the SAR and Spokane County representatives - specifically Rob Lindsay, Water Programs Manager,  and Mike Hermanson, Water Resources Manager. 

Spokane County commissioners have responded to Hirst with a temporary ordinance which allows most development to continue in Spokane County, with a few exceptions - one being property on/near the Little Spokane River.
 
The county is talking about creating the Little Spokane Water Bank from an existing Deer Park Farms water right and intends to sell water rights for a potential 3,445 parcels in that water shed.  Water rights are parcel-specific but can be transferred to future owners of that parcel.   Prices would start at $1,000, one time purchase, for a simple water right. 
 
County Commissioners will see a draft proposal on this water bank next week, then begin deliberations toward its implementation this fall.
 
The County is considering creating other water banks in other water sheds as a long-term solution to moving forward with rural development in a post-Hirst environment.

Pack the Pantry - Final Count




2017 Pack the Pantry event chair Judy Flemmer (Exit Real Estate Professionals) and co-chair Jamie DeHaven (Windermere City Group), report a final count from our recently-completed SAR food drive for 2nd Harvest:
Money collected: $10,722.04

Pounds of food collected: 21,742

The money and poundage we collected translate into 71,728 meals that will be served at local tables.

Thank you to all of our volunteers and donors who helped make this year's event such a success!

The Oak Tree Seeks Contractor



Spokane City Council member Karen Stratton shares word that The Oak Tree - a Spokane non-profit - is seeking a contractor to finish work on five homes in the West Central neighborhood.  The homes were previously scheduled for demolition, then moved for renovation to be low income housing.
 
Some work has been done; all of the houses need to be finished and made habitable.  Funding is available.

RPR Mobile

  
   
 
RPR's app is a must have tool for real estate agents who rely on instant access to information while on the road with prospects and customers.  
 
With more than 338,000 downloads to date, the app provides REALTORS® with hundreds of real estate data sets ranging from property characteristics, photos, tax and mortgage history and valuations to neighborhood and school information, and more.
 
Now, the app's offerings have been expanded to include Comps Analysis Express--a simple, intuitive interface to create an on-the-go CMA using a phone or tablet.
